Delaware County Community College Undergraduate Tuition and Fees

In 2019-2020, the average part-time undergraduate tuition at Delaware County Community College was $375 per credit hour for out-of-state students. The average for in-state students was $250 per credit hour. Information about average full-time undergraduate tuition and fees is shown in the table below.

In StateOut of State
Tuition$7,500$11,250
Fees$2,210$2,300
Books and Supplies$2,500$2,500

Does Delaware County Community College Offer an Online Associate in Electroneurodiagnostic/Electroencephalographic Technology/Technologist?

Delaware County Community College does not offer an online option for its electroneurodiagnostic/electroencephalographic technology/technologist associate degree program at this time.
